AI在线 AI在线

DeepSeek,2025 最值得学习十个 Vue3 库源码?

VueUse - 组合式API工具集GitHub: ,提供 200 组合式 API 函数。 其模块化架构和TypeScript 类型系统堪称典范,适合学习如何组织大型工具类项目。 源码中可重点研究 useStorage 的状态同步机制和 useEventListener 的事件管理设计2.

1. VueUse - 组合式API工具集

GitHub: https://github.com/vueuse/vueuse

Vue3官方推荐的工具库,提供 200+ 组合式 API 函数。其模块化架构和TypeScript 类型系统堪称典范,适合学习如何组织大型工具类项目。源码中可重点研究 useStorage 的状态同步机制和 useEventListener 的事件管理设计

DeepSeek,2025 最值得学习十个 Vue3 库源码?

2. Pinia - 下一代状态管理

GitHub: https://github.com/vuejs/pinia

Vue 官方状态管理库,源码仅 800 行却实现了完整的状态管理方案。值得学习其响应式系统与 Vue3 的深度集成,以及通过 defineStore 实现的可扩展架构。其TypeScript类型推导系统尤其值得借鉴

DeepSeek,2025 最值得学习十个 Vue3 库源码?

3. Naive UI - 企业级组件库

GitHub: https://github.com/tusen-ai/naive-ui

采用 Vue3 最新语法构建的UI库,组件实现干净无冗余代码。推荐研究其主题定制系统(n-config-provider)和 useDialog 等高级组合式API的实现,学习如何设计高扩展性组件

DeepSeek,2025 最值得学习十个 Vue3 库源码?

4. Vue Router - 路由核心库

GitHub: https://github.com/vuejs/router

官方路由库源码展示了如何深度集成 Vue3 响应式系统。重点关注其路由守卫实现和滚动行为控制逻辑,学习如何设计可扩展的路由中间件系统

DeepSeek,2025 最值得学习十个 Vue3 库源码?

5. Vitest - 单元测试框架

GitHub: https://github.com/vitest-dev/vitest

专为 Vue3 设计的测试框架,源码中可学习现代测试工具的设计理念。重点分析其组件测试渲染器实现,以及如何利用Vite的HMR特性加速测试运行

DeepSeek,2025 最值得学习十个 Vue3 库源码?

6. Vee-Validate - 表单验证方案

GitHub: https://github.com/logaretm/vee-validate

表单验证领域的标杆项目,其基于 Yup 的验证架构和 useForm 组合式 API 实现值得深入研究。学习如何设计可扩展的验证规则系统和高性能的错误处理机制

DeepSeek,2025 最值得学习十个 Vue3 库源码?

7. Vue Draggable - 拖拽交互库

GitHub: https://github.com/SortableJS/vue.draggable.next

基于 Sortable.js 的 Vue3 封装,源码展示了如何将传统库与现代响应式系统结合。重点研究其与 Transition 组件的集成方式,以及如何优化拖拽性能

DeepSeek,2025 最值得学习十个 Vue3 库源码?

8. VueRequest - 数据请求管理

GitHub: https://github.com/AttoJS/vue-request

优雅的请求状态管理方案,源码中可学习到:

  • 请求节流/防抖的实现
  • 自动重试机制设计
  • 基于响应式的缓存策略

其插件系统设计对构建可扩展工具库具有参考价值

DeepSeek,2025 最值得学习十个 Vue3 库源码?

9. Vue DevTools Next - 调试工具

GitHub: https://github.com/vuejs/devtools-next

新版开发者工具源码展示了如何与 Vue3 内部 API 交互。通过研究其组件树渲染逻辑和时间旅行调试实现,可深入理解 Vue3 运行时机制

DeepSeek,2025 最值得学习十个 Vue3 库源码?

10. Vue Macros - 语法扩展工具

GitHub: https://github.com/vue-macros/vue-macros

通过编译器宏扩展Vue语法,源码中可学习:

  • AST语法树操作技巧
  • 自定义编译器插件的实现
  • 与Vite/Webpack的深度集成

是学习现代编译技术的绝佳案例

DeepSeek,2025 最值得学习十个 Vue3 库源码?

相关资讯

AI 神器!一键把 Vue3 源码解析成文档!

在开发过程中,开发者们常常需要深入理解各种开源项目的源码,以便更好地利用和学习。 然而,面对复杂的源码,往往感到无从下手。 最近,一款名为 DeepWiki 的 AI 工具为这一问题提供了全新的解决方案,它能够一键将 Vue3 源码转换为清晰易懂的文档。
5/16/2025 10:50:36 AM
小4子

Vue3 最强大的 AI 组件库!华为重磅开源!

前言大家好,我是林三心,用最通俗易懂的话讲最难的知识点是我的座右铭,基础是进阶的前提是我的初心~图片MateChat 是一款专为智能对话场景设计的 Vue UI 组件库,具备开箱即用、接入门槛低的特点,并提供国际化与多主题支持,能够轻松适配多端平台。 该组件库持续迭代,已在 V1.1 版本中新增 Markdown 卡片渲染、高定制化主题等实用能力。 解决的核心问题:降低开发成本:传统方式实现 AI 对话界面需手动编写聊天布局、角色区分、输入框及提示模块,重复开发工作量大;统一交互体验:多平台下 UI 和语言风格不一致,MateChat 提供一致的专业体验;简化主题适配:内置明/暗色主题,并通过 CSS 变量支持扩展,减少 UI 适配负担;赋能复杂场景:帮助网站或 IDE 插件快速集成 AI 助手,降低技术门槛。
9/2/2025 5:00:00 AM
林三心不学挖掘机

OpenAI首席研究官:DeepSeek独立发现了o1的一些核心思路,奥特曼、LeCun纷纷置评

成本打下来了,需求更多才对? 春节这几天,国内外 AI 圈都被 DeepSeek 刷了屏。 英伟达的股市震荡更是让全世界看得目瞪口呆(参见《英伟达市值蒸发近 6000 亿美元,而 DeepSeek 刚刚又开源新模型》)。
1/29/2025 6:43:00 PM
机器之心
  • 1